About Padliya

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Padliya village is 098082. Padliya village is located in Sagwara tehsil of Dungarpur district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Sagwara (tehsildar office) and 32km away from district headquarter Dungarpur. As per 2009 stats, Piplagunj is the gram panchayat of Padliya village.

The total geographical area of village is 403.16 hectares. Padliya has a total population of 997 peoples, out of which male population is 478 while female population is 519. Literacy rate of padliya village is 46.34% out of which 57.53% males and 36.03% females are literate. There are about 223 houses in padliya village. Pincode of padliya village locality is 314401.

Sagwara is nearest town to padliya for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.
